What should I look for in the ingredients list of canned dog food?

A high-quality canned dog food should have real meat, such as chicken, beef, or fish, listed as the first ingredient. Avoid options with meat by-products or low-quality protein sources, such as corn gluten meal or soy protein isolate, as they may not offer the necessary nutrients for your dog’s health.

Additionally, look for a balanced mix of vitamins, minerals, and fiber from sources like vegetables and grains. Avoid excessive additives, artificial preservatives, and artificial colors that may negatively impact your dog’s health. Consult your veterinarian for guidance on selecting a canned dog food with the appropriate ingredients for your dog’s breed and dietary needs.

How many times a day should I feed my dog canned dog food?

The feeding frequency for canned dog food depends on your dog’s breed, size, age, and activity level. Generally, adult dogs should be fed two to three times a day, with the amount of food adjusted based on their energy needs and overall health. Puppies and senior dogs may require more frequent feeding to meet their nutritional needs and maintain a healthy weight.

It is crucial to follow the feeding guidelines provided by your dog’s veterinarian and the canned dog food manufacturer. Overfeeding or underfeeding your dog can lead to obesity or malnutrition, respectively. Monitor your dog’s weight and consult your veterinarian if you have concerns about their feeding regimen or overall health.

How can I transition my dog to canned dog food from a dry kibble?

When transitioning your dog from dry kibble to canned dog food, it’s essential to do so gradually to avoid upsetting their stomach. Start by mixing a small amount of the canned food with your dog’s current kibble, gradually increasing the proportion of canned food over a period of 7 to 10 days. Monitor your dog for any signs of digestive upset, such as diarrhea or vomiting, and adjust the transition period accordingly.

If your dog is particularly resistant to the change in diet, you can try offering the canned food as a topper or mix-in for their current kibble. This allows them to become accustomed to the flavor and texture of the canned food without having to fully switch diets. Consult with your veterinarian for guidance on transitioning your dog’s diet and for any specific concerns related to their health.

How long does canned dog food typically last once opened?

Once opened, canned dog food should be refrigerated and consumed within two to three days. Proper storage is essential to maintain the food’s quality and prevent bacterial growth. If your dog cannot finish the canned food within this time frame, consider purchasing a smaller portion at a time or freezing any unused portions in an airtight container for later use.

Always check the canned dog food for signs of spoilage, such as a foul smell, discoloration, or visible mold, before serving it to your dog. Discard any canned food that shows signs of spoilage and purchase a fresh can for your dog’s next meal.
